Silicon Control Inc.
Silicon Control bus analyzers are powerful diagnostic tools used in the design, development, integration, test and support of computer systems. All of our bus analyzers are single plug-in boards that capture and stimulate bus activity. Built-in features include tracing bus events, anomaly detection, performance analysis, compliance testing, master functions, stimulus pattern generation, target memory and more!

Product
VME Bus Tester
VBT100
-
The VBT100 has been designed to withstand and measure excessive voltages on both signal and power supply pins. This capability allows it to operate in faulty backplanes that could damage other boards. The tester also detects, measures and identifies which signals have excessive voltages so they can be repaired before boards are loaded into a backplane.

Product
Bus Analyzer / Exerciser
VME850P2
-
The VME850P2 analyzer is an optional plug on module for the VME850 analyzer that adds analyzer and exerciser functions to the VME850 analyzer for the P2 connector. This module allows the user to monitor and stimulate the A, C and D rows of the 160 pin P2 connector. Although the VME850P2 analyzer is in a PMC form factor it is not compatible with the PMC protocols and signaling. The signaling levels on the P2 connector must be less then 5V in order to prevent damage of the analyzer.

Product
Bus Analyzer / Exerciser
VME850
-
The VME850 Analyzer / Exerciser supports the latest VME bus specifications and protocols. From standard VME transfers to 2eSST protocol. In addition to the VME bus, user defined signals on the P0 and P2 connectors are also analyzed and exercised with optional plug-in modules.
